    Broken or Damaged Hinges

    Hinges are exposed to a lot of stress from daily use and can become stiff or damaged over time. Drops and bumps that happen accidentally can also cause damage to hinges. To avoid further damage or costly repairs, it's important to fix the issue as soon as you can.

    There are several ways to fix damaged or broken hinges depending on the kind of hinge. If you have a screw in style hinge, you can try using wood putty or bondo and filling the hole. But, this is only a temporary solution that will wear away over time. You can also purchase an repair plate for your cabinet hinges that is large enough to cover the damaged area and comes with new holes to screw into.

    Dowels and epoxy is a different option. This is a longer-lasting solution, but it will require some technical know-how. You'll need to determine the diameter of the hole and purchase dowels with the same diameter. Dowels must be cut to the proper size, and then glued with epoxy. Push the dowels into the wood until they are completely flush. This will ensure that the screws will be able to hold on the hinges when you reattach them.

    Lintels damaged Lintels

    Lintels are important for the structural integrity of your home because they assist in reducing the weight of brick walls above windows, doors and other openings in walls. They are made from different materials, but they are susceptible to deterioration due to aging and damp. This could cause collapse and put the structure at risk. It is important to have your lintels repaired as quickly as you can in order to avoid costly repairs to lintels.

    Cracks visible above windows and doors are typically the most obvious sign of problems with lintels. The cracks usually show up as vertically stepped cracks which are able to move diagonally from the edge of an opening. This kind of cracking is a clear signal that the lintel is no longer able to support the wall over it.

    If you aren't sure if your lintel is damaged, you should seek the services of a professional structural engineer to assess your building. They will be able to advise you on the best repair method for lintel for your property.

    Steel rods are used to strengthen concrete lintels, improving their strength and durability. However, these rods may corrode over time and start to expand, causing the concrete above them to crack. A lintel repair near me must include the replacement of this steel and a waterproofing treatment to prevent any further issues.

    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pgLintels made of wood can be affected by dampness which can cause wood rot. This requires repairs to the lintel. In this instance, it may be required to replace the old lintel with a new one made of helical bar. These reinforcement bars are joined with anchor grout to form solid beam of masonry. These reinforcement bars are an excellent replacement for traditional timber lintels. They can also be used to strengthen bricks or masonry Lintels.
